Bhangali - Firozpur, Ferozepur

Bhangali is a village situated in the Firozpur tehsil of Ferozepur district, Punjab. It is located approximately 25 km from Firozpur and around 25 km from Firozpur. Bhangali village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Bhangali is 034468. The village covers a total geographical area of 214 hectares and falls under the 142052 pincode. Talwandi Bhai is the nearest town.

Bhangali village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Guru har sahai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Firozp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Bhangali

As per Census 2011, Bhangali village has a total population of 618 people, consisting of 320 males and 298 females. The village has 126 households and a sex ratio of 931 females per 1,000 males. There are 63 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 434 literate and 184 illiterate residents. Additionally, 183 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Bhangali

Public transport in the Bhangali is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Sulhani, while the nearest airport is Sri Guru Ram Dass Jee International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 78.0 km.
